A Note on Adaptive Group LassoHansheng WangPeking University - Guanghua School of Management Chenlei Lengaffiliation not provided to SSRN November 27, 2008 Computational Statistics & Data Analysis, Vol. 52, pp. 5277-5286, 2008 Abstract: Group lasso is a natural extension of lasso and selects variables in a grouped manner. However, group lasso suffers from estimation inefficiency and selection inconsistency. To remedy these problems, we propose the adaptive group lasso method. We show theoretically that the new method is able to identify the true model consistently, and the resulting estimator can be as efficient as oracle. Numerical studies confirmed our theoretical findings.
